Investment is the process of committing money or resources to an endeavor with the expectation of generating a profit or achieving some form of financial return. It is a cornerstone of personal finance, business strategy, and economic growth. People invest for various reasons, including building wealth, preparing for retirement, or securing their children’s education. The most common forms of investment include stocks, bonds, mutual funds, real estate, and increasingly, digital assets like cryptocurrencies. Each investment type carries its own level of risk and potential reward, and understanding these dynamics is key to making informed decisions.

When individuals invest, they are essentially choosing to delay current consumption in hopes of greater future returns. For example, purchasing shares in a company allows investors to potentially earn dividends and benefit from the company's growth through stock appreciation. On the other hand, more conservative options like government bonds offer lower returns but come with significantly reduced risk. Diversification, or spreading investments across multiple asset classes, is a common strategy to manage risk and stabilize returns.

This is why many financial advisors encourage starting early, even with small amounts. Additionally, staying informed about market trends, global events, and economic indicators can help investors make more strategic choices.

Investing is not just for the wealthy. With the rise of digital platforms and mobile apps, more people than ever have access to financial markets. Many of these platforms offer fractional shares and low fees, making it easier for beginners to get started. However, while accessibility has improved, so has the need for financial literacy. Understanding concepts like risk tolerance, asset allocation, and market cycles is crucial.

 

Ultimately, investment is a powerful tool for achieving financial goals, but it requires patience, research, and discipline. Whether it's planning for a home, retirement, or simply growing wealth, smart investing can provide both security and opportunity over time.
